Dua Lipa ignites Miami with a tribute to Gloria Estefan and her iconic "Conga."

Dua Lipa surprised Miami during her Radical Optimism Tour by performing "Conga" in honor of Gloria Estefan, highlighting the influence of Latin music and celebrating iconic artists.

Dua Lipa at her concert in MiamiPhoto © Instagram / Dua Lipa

The British-Albanian singer Dua Lipa paid tribute to the Cuban Gloria Estefan during her concert at the Kaseya Center in Miami, on the first night of her Radical Optimism Tour in the city.

Before thousands of fans, the Grammy winner surprised everyone by performing the iconic song “Conga,” the hit that propelled Estefan to fame with her group Miami Sound Machine.

To the rhythm of this song and with a vibrant performance, Lipa managed to get the entire audience on their feet with her rendition of one of the most representative musical anthems of Latin and Miami culture.

The gesture did not go unnoticed by Gloria Estefan, who responded enthusiastically on her social media: "I love Dua Lipa and I loved her version of 'Conga' here in Miami! Thank you! I am a big fan!", wrote the Cuban artist, grateful and excited about the performance.

“Conga” was released as the first single from the album Primitive Love in 1985, becoming one of the biggest hits in Latin music in the United States and a symbol of the distinctive sound of Miami Sound Machine.

With this tribute, Dua Lipa not only connected with the musical spirit of Miami but also celebrated the influence of Latino artists, especially Gloria Estefan, one of the most influential figures in Cuban music in the United States.
